1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the shaft of the bone called?
Back
Diaphysis
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Where are blood vessels and nerves located in compact bone?
Back
Central canal
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the medullary cavity?
Back
The central cavity of bone where bone marrow is stored.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the periosteum?
Back
A dense layer of vascular connective tissue enveloping the bones except at the surfaces of the joints.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the epiphysis?
Back
The end part of a long bone, initially growing separately from the shaft.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are osteons?
Back
The structural unit of compact bone, consisting of a central canal surrounded by concentric rings of bone matrix.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are lamellae?
Back
Thin layers of bone matrix that form the structure of osteons.
